Crafting proposal feedback surveys
Crafting proposal feedback surveys can be made easier with the help of ChatGPT. ChatGPT is a language model that can assist you in generating survey questions and feedback templates. By providing prompts and context, ChatGPT can help you create effective and concise surveys that can help you gather valuable feedback from your stakeholders.
Prompts
In an effort to optimize the data collection process and ensure we obtain the most relevant and actionable feedback on our recently proposed project, [Project Name], I solicit your assistance in the generation of comprehensive survey questions. The target respondents for this survey include our [stakeholders/clients/customers] and we aim to gain deep insights on various aspects of our proposal that were well-received, areas that did not quite resonate, as well as suggestions for potential improvement. βTo ensure consistency in the survey questions and facilitate a thorough analysis of the feedback, please consider a blend of both qualitative and quantitative questions, incorporating Likert scale responses, multiple-choice options, open-ended questions, and ranking systems where applicable. βFor an effective feedback loop, we need to understand the reasons behind their [likes/dislikes/suggestions for improvement] about our proposal, so that we can tailor our approach, refine our strategy, and enhance the overall quality of our work. βWe encourage the use of probing questions to dig deeper into their perceptions and attitudes, and also consider questions that address both macro and micro perspectives of our proposal. The ultimate goal is to obtain a 360-degree view of our proposalβs impact and performance from the standpoint of our [stakeholders/clients/customers].
